## MLX Engine (Optional)
|
||||
|
||||
The MLX engine enables running safetensor based models. It requires building the [MLX](https://github.com/ml-explore/mlx) and [MLX-C](https://github.com/ml-explore/mlx-c) shared libraries separately via CMake. On MacOS, MLX leverages the Metal library to run on the GPU, and on Windows and Linux, runs on NVIDIA GPUs via CUDA v13.
|
||||
|
||||
### macOS (Apple Silicon)
|
||||
|
||||
Requires the Metal toolchain. Install [Xcode](https://developer.apple.com/xcode/) first, then:
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
xcodebuild -downloadComponent MetalToolchain
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Verify it's installed correctly (should print "no input files"):
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
xcrun metal
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Then build:
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
cmake -B build --preset MLX
|
||||
cmake --build build --preset MLX --parallel
|
||||
cmake --install build --component MLX
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
> [!NOTE]
|
||||
> Without the Metal toolchain, cmake will silently complete with Metal disabled. Check the cmake output for `Setting MLX_BUILD_METAL=OFF` which indicates the toolchain is missing.

### Windows / Linux (CUDA)
|
||||
|
||||
Requires CUDA 13+ and [cuDNN](https://developer.nvidia.com/cudnn) 9+.
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
cmake -B build --preset "MLX CUDA 13"
|
||||
cmake --build build --target mlx --target mlxc --config Release --parallel
|
||||
cmake --install build --component MLX --strip
|
||||
```

### Local MLX source overrides
|
||||
|
||||
To build against a local checkout of MLX and/or MLX-C (useful for development), set environment variables before running CMake:
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
export OLLAMA_MLX_SOURCE=/path/to/mlx
|
||||
export OLLAMA_MLX_C_SOURCE=/path/to/mlx-c
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
For example, using the helper scripts with local mlx and mlx-c repos:
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
OLLAMA_MLX_SOURCE=../mlx OLLAMA_MLX_C_SOURCE=../mlx-c ./scripts/build_linux.sh
|
||||
|
||||
OLLAMA_MLX_SOURCE=../mlx OLLAMA_MLX_C_SOURCE=../mlx-c ./scripts/build_darwin.sh
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
```powershell
|
||||
$env:OLLAMA_MLX_SOURCE="../mlx"
|
||||
$env:OLLAMA_MLX_C_SOURCE="../mlx-c"
|
||||
./scripts/build_darwin.ps1
|
||||
```
